Pavers Hardscaping Questions
What types of surfaces can pavers be used on? Pavers are suitable for driveways, walkways, patios, and pool decks, providing durable and attractive surfaces for various outdoor areas.
Are pavers a good choice for outdoor landscaping? Yes, pavers add visual appeal and functionality to landscaping projects, including garden paths and decorative borders.
What materials are commonly used for pavers? Common materials include concrete, brick, and natural stone, each offering different styles and durability levels.
How do pavers compare to other hardscaping options? Pavers are versatile and easier to repair or replace compared to poured concrete or asphalt surfaces.
